spec/omniauth/strategies/boletosimples_spec.rb in omniauth-boletosimples-0.0.1 vs spec/omniauth/strategies/boletosimples_spec.rb in omniauth-boletosimples-0.0.2
- old
+ new
@@ -32,9 +32,16 @@
end
it 'has correct token url' do
subject.client.options[:token_url].should eq('/api/v1/oauth2/token')
end
+
+ it 'has correct connection_opts' do
+ @options = { :user_agent => 'email@example.com' }
+ subject.setup_phase
+ subject.client.options[:connection_opts].should eq({:headers=>{:"User-Agent"=>"email@example.com"}})
+ end
+
end
describe '#callback_path' do
it "has the correct callback path" do
subject.callback_path.should eq('/auth/boletosimples/callback')